Everyone knows that taking a break is a good thing and considering some of the challenges of the past year, maintaining regular breaks in our daily routines should be of the utmost importance in helping both our physical and mental health.

However, since working from home, 39% of us say we are working more hours in the day but, on average, are only taking two breaks each lasting just 12 minutes, according to new research by digital magazine and newspaper app Readly.

In fact, 28% say the number of breaks they take during the work day has decreased since they started working from home and 46% say they feel guilty when taking a break.

Aston spoke to Donna Air, actress & TV presenter to talk about her tips for creating space to relax and to encourage the nation to remember that breaks are vital for our emotional, mental, and physical wellbeing.
